femme fashion<br />

New Year, New Fabulous You<br />

By Adrian Nguyen<br />

Time flew by this year; it feels<br />

like I was writing this same<br />

column just yesterday. This<br />

time I’m dedicating this to all<br />

the women who have come<br />

up to me at parties to talk<br />

about trends. So let’s glam up<br />

for 2011.<br />

Colour crush<br />

If you love pink, this will be<br />

your season—honeysuckle<br />

is the colour for spring. I’m<br />

loving this and I have been<br />

collecting all shades of it since<br />

autumn. You will see it in my<br />

wardrobe as well as in my collections.<br />

Coral and beeswax<br />

are also making it big so start<br />

refreshing your closet now.<br />

Polka dot<br />

Just like stripes, polka dots<br />

have always been around but<br />

this season they’re coming on<br />

a little bit stronger—and we<br />

see them everywhere, from<br />

Giles to Moschino to Louis<br />

Vuitton. But if you don’t really<br />

have a Gisele Bundchen body<br />

then just wear one item with<br />

the dots or you’re gonna end<br />

up looking like your six-yearold<br />

daughter.<br />

Tassel/fringe<br />

It’s making a big impact right<br />

now among fashionistas.<br />

Choose the sleek and smooth<br />

form of fringe and if you don't<br />

want to look like a piece of<br />

furniture, then choose the tassels<br />

for your accessories like<br />

bags, shoes, or belts while<br />

reserving the fringe for your<br />

dresses. Check out Gucci and<br />

Roberto Cavalli Spring 2011<br />

for inspiration.<br />

Seventies<br />

Will this decade ever be<br />

forgotten because it keeps<br />

reappearing on the fashion<br />

scene Sometimes I feel like it<br />

was never really gone—I think<br />

it’s the most fabulous decade.<br />

I shouldn't need to give you<br />

tips on this—don't we all<br />

know what the Seventies look<br />

like Look out for my friend<br />

Boma, she’ll show you how<br />

do it right.<br />

Bob/bang<br />

If the clothes can be seventies,<br />

then why not your hair<br />

The bob is back after a hiatus;<br />

this time it’s got a softer feel<br />

to it and more retro-inspired<br />

evidenced by the more<br />

rounded shape. It needs to<br />

be neatly blow-waved under<br />

a straight edge. And while<br />

you’re at it, give yourself<br />

bangs too. Look up Jane<br />

Birkin. They don't name a bag<br />

after her for no good-reason!<br />

I hope these tips are<br />

enough to get you into the<br />

New Year with panache. If you<br />

bump into me around town,<br />

I’ll be more than happy to talk<br />

style and fashion. Have a very<br />

happy and stylish new year.<br />
